Where to Use with Caution
While the I Don t Like Morning People SVG Cut File is versatile, it may not be ideal for every embroidery project. Here are a few scenarios where extra care is needed:
- Small hoop sizes: The design has enough detail that it may not translate well to very small hoops. Test it first to ensure the text remains readable.
- Dark fabrics: If you plan to use it on dark-colored materials, double-check that the thread color provides sufficient contrast.
- Stretchy or textured fabrics: These can affect how the stitches lay, so using a proper stabilizer is essential to prevent distortion.
- Curved surfaces: Using it on items like caps or mugs requires careful placement and possibly adjusting the design slightly for curvature.

Embroidery Designer Notes: Tips for Success
If you’re planning to use the I Don t Like Morning People SVG Cut File in your embroidery project, here are a few practical tips:
- Test on scrap fabric before committing to a final product. This helps identify any potential issues with stitch density or thread visibility.
- Check thread color contrast—especially if you’re using it on dark or light backgrounds.
- Review stitch density to ensure it won’t cause puckering or stiffness on delicate fabrics.
- Confirm hoop size and adjust the design if necessary for smaller or larger formats.
- Inspect small details to ensure they remain visible after stitching, especially if you’re scaling the design.
- Use printable mockups to visualize how it will look on different products before production.
- Check licensing terms if you plan to sell finished items or digital products based on this design.
